- Dual light sources- Blue Laser: 38 laser lines (19 + 19 crossed) for fast, large-area scanning + 7 parallel laser lines for fine detail, Optimized capability for deep-hole scanning, Capability to scan black or reflective surfaces without spray, Great material adaptability, Ideal for industrial parts like automotive components

- Dual light sources- IR VCSEL: From face to feet, scan safely and fast within just 60 seconds, High efficiency for medium to large objects, Performs well outdoors and in bright environments, Hybrid alignment (texture + feature) to adapt to different scan scenarios

- True Wireless built-in Wi-Fi 3D scanning with real-time sync to PC, Built-in, Swappable internal battery with up to 3 hours runtime, Stable real-time sync to PC, Cable connection available if Wi-Fi interference occurs


- Built-in 5 MP color camera for vivid textures capture, Adds realistic details and depth to 3D models, Marker-free scanning at rich detailed surfaces, Up to 90 fps with marker alignment for smooth, real-time capture, High-quality point cloud with clean and consistent output you can trust, Perfect for AR/VR, digital art and custom designs

- Ready for Outdoor Scanning: Reliable performance in daylight and varied lighting, Laser HD mode works up to 110,000 Lux and IR Rapid mode up to 70,000 Lux for reliable scanning even in bright light environment, Perfect for scanning outdoor objects like statues, sculptures, and more
